WebNational Center for Biotechnology Information Web21 mag 2024 · 5.3 The Role of Glutamine Metabolism in Cancer-Associated Fibroblasts. Fibroblasts play a key role in solid tumors, fulfilling important functions like secreting growth factors, remodeling the extracellular matrix, and promoting metastasis [ 148 ]. They may also influence the metabolic behaviors of cancer cells.

Web13 apr 2024 · OXPHOS-high mitochondria in LUAD cells utilized diverse nutrient sources, including glucose, glutamine, and fatty acids, the researchers found. They also pinpointed a subpopulation of peridroplet mitochondria (PDM) wrapped around lipid droplets in these cells. By contrast, OXPHOS-low mitochondria relied on glucose and glutamine metabolism. Web1 ago 2024 · 6-Diazo-5-oxo-L-norleucine (L-DON), azaserine, and acivicin are secreted as antibiotics by Streptomyces bacteria and act as irreversible glutamine-competitive inhibitors of amidotransferases and glutaminases [ 24] ( Figure 2). All of these glutamine mimetics are cytotoxic and have shown anticancer efficacy in mice.
